Deborah Heart and Lung Center Awarded CAP Accreditation

Deborah Heart and Lung Center’s Pathology Department has received a two year re-accreditation from the College of American Pathologists (CAP). This prestigious industry standard underscores the excellent standards maintained by Deborah’s pathology labs.

“Our lab staff works hard each and every day to maintain accuracy and precision in our laboratory testing,” said Betsy L. Schloo, MD, Deborah’s Chair, Pathology Department. “I am proud that we have been recognized for adhering to the highest professional quality standards.”

The nationally respected CAP Laboratory Accreditation Program dispatches site inspectors who examine the laboratory’s records and quality control for procedures, as well as the lab staff’s qualification, equipment, facilities, safety program and record, and overall management.

“It is vitally important for our patients to know that Deborah maintains and exceeds national benchmark standards for testing and lab services,” she added. “This is a testament to the exacting professional
standards our staff holds themselves to. Lab tests are a vital part of medical care at Deborah and this accreditation demonstrates our highest level of care.”
